About this listen

What’s Next in Franchising is a podcast for leaders scaling home and commercial services franchises, where growth puts real pressure on operations, teams, and culture. Each episode explores what changes as franchise systems grow—across labor, technology, training, and field execution—through a weekly franchise news review and in-depth conversations with operators and executives actively building service brands. The show is hosted by Leighton Healey, CEO of KnowHow, who has led from every seat in franchising: franchisee, franchisor, and now a technology founder.     Most franchisors pour everything into their annual conference and walk away three weeks later wondering why nothing changed. In this episode, Leighton Healey breaks down what actually separates a great franchise conference from an expensive one—drawing on decades of experience across dozens of franchise brands.

    He covers the FBC prep practice most brands skip, how to use vendor relationships as a competitive intelligence tool, and why the Monday after your conference is where ROI goes to die.

    Franchise growth is accelerating in lockstep with rising pressure on operations.

    In the first episode of What’s Next in Franchising, Leighton Healey and Travis Martin introduce the show and break down three developments shaping service franchising in 2026:

    • FTC franchise disclosure updates and what greater transparency means for franchisors
    • The latest Franchise 500 rankings and how visibility raises expectations across systems
    • The shift away from DIY as consumers return to professional service providers

    This episode sets the foundation for the conversations ahead, focusing on how franchise leaders can navigate growth without losing quality, culture, or their people.
